The Emergency First Aid at Work (EFAW) course is an important training program designed to equip individuals with the important abilities and understanding called for to provide reliable first aid in emergency circumstances in the workplace. This course is especially useful for marked first aiders in smaller work environments or for those sustaining completely certified first aiders in bigger companies.

Duration and Certification.
The EFAW course generally lasts eventually and includes both theoretical understanding and useful training. Upon effective conclusion, individuals get a certification, which is normally valid for 3 years. Hereafter duration, a correspondence course or requalification may be required to keep capability and compliance with work environment policies.
